HPA基因多态性及其等位基因对血小板输注效果的影响
Effect of HPA gene polymorphism and its alleles on platelet transfusion

作  者: (李玉梅); (徐恒仕); (王志良);

机构地区: 上海交通大学医学院附属第九人民医院输血科,上海201900

出  处: 《中国输血杂志》 2017年第7期744-747,共4页

摘  要: 目的探讨HPA基因多态性及其等位基因对血小板输注效果的影响。方法自2015年1月-2017年1月,连续性收集50例本院收治的血小板输注无效患者作为观察组,同期收集50例血小板输注有效的患者作为对照组,观察2组患者HPA基因多态性。结果与对照组比较,观察组患者供患双方HPA分型相合率显著降低(4.00%vs 82.00%,P<0.05);血小板恢复百分比显著降低[(11.91±3.23)%vs(31.56±7.38)%,P<0.05);血小板纠正增加指数显著降低(6.84±2.27 vs 16.38±1.92,P<0.05)。2组患者HPA等位基因(HPA1-6,9,15)均以纯合子aa为多见。但观察组HPA-2等位基因为aa、ab、bb的分别有37、8、5例,对照组分别有48、2、0例,差异有统计学意义(P<0.05);观察组HPA-3等位基因为aa、ab、bb的分别有33、9、8例,对照组分别有46、3、1例,差异有统计学差异(P<0.05)。观察组HPA-15等位基因为aa、ab、bb的分别有35、8、7例,对照组分别有47、2、1例,差异有统计学意义(P<0.05)。2组患者的血小板供者HPA等位基因(HPA1-6,9,15)均以纯合子aa为多见,差异均无统计学意义(P>0.05)。血小板输注无效患者HPA-2,3等位基因为aa、ab和bb的血小板恢复百分比、血小板纠正增加指数逐步下降(P<0.05)。结论血小板输注无效与HPA基因多态性有关,等位基因型b可能是导致血小板输注无效的原因。 Objective To investigate the effect of HPA gene polymorphism and its alleles on platelet transfusion. Meth-ocls From January 2015 to January 2017, 50 patients suffered from Platelet transfusion refractoriness were collected as an observation group while 50 patients without Platelet transfusion refractoriness were collected as a control group. The HPA gene polymorphism of the both groups were compared. Results When compared with the control group, the HPA type coincidence rate of Donor and recipient in the observation group decreased significantly (4. 00% vs. 82. 00%, P= 0. 000). And patients in the observation group got decreased levels of percent platelet recovery and platelet corrected growth index. ( HPA1- 6,9,15) were common in both groups. However, aa, ab and bb of the HPA-2 allele got 37, 8 and 5 cases in the observation group, while there were 48, 2 and 0 eases in the control group (P= 0. 007). And aa, ab and bb of the HPA-3 allele got 33, 9 and 8 cases in the observation group, while there were 46, 3 and 1 cases in the control group (P = 0. 005). Moreover, aa, ab and bb of the HPA-15 allele got 35, 8 and 7 cases in the observation group, while there were 47, 2 and 1 eases in the control group (P = 0. 007). Homozygous aa were the most common gene type in the donors of the both groups, and the difference was no statistically significant (P〉0. 05). As aa, ab and bb of the HPA-2,3 change, the percent platelet recovery and platelet corrected growth index both decreased (P〈0. 05). Conehmion Platelet transfusion refractoriness is related to HPA gene polymorphism, and allele b may be the cause of platelet transfusion refractoriness.
